On 4/30/2023 at 10:43 AM, ray c said:

dont like the points system total boring 

The points system as it is now is pretty much in line with other major motor sports (MotoGP, F1), i.e. you get championship points for your placing overall in the meeting. I think this is OK. The only thing that's out of whack with the others sports is that the difference between the winner and the runner up / third should be greater - you should be rewarded by a higher increment if you win.

Speedway isn't road racign or motox, we dont have ONE race, we have 23 ! And in every heat the winner gets the most points anyway, 3-2-1-0, just like it should be, so what's wrong with that?

With the new point system top riders like Zmarzlik simply don't have to fight for every point during the heats anymore. It shows in the racing, which is not as intensive as used to be when every single point counted.
